Что лучше для Windows 10: UEFI или Legacy

Для начала определим, что такое UEFI и Legacy. UEFI (Unified Extensible Firmware Interface — объединённый интерфейс расширяемой прошивки) представляет собой набор микропрограмм материнской платы, которые отвечают за её запуск и взаимодействие с установленным аппаратным обеспечением. Под Legacy же подразумевается старый набор служебного ПО, более известный как BIOS (Basic Input-Output System). Несмотря на общее предназначение, оба варианта значительно отличаются. Главным различием является графический интерфейс в UEFI, который, ко всему прочему, поддерживает управление мышью. В BIOS же используется исключительно клавиатура.

Менее очевидным пользователям, но не менее важным отличием является поддержка загрузочных разделов объёмом больше 2,1 Тб и формата GPT. Последний представляет собой почти что обязательное условие для установки Windows 10. Соответственно, если на этот компьютер попробовать инсталлировать Windows 7, ничего не получится – загрузочный раздел необходимо либо форматировать, либо конвертировать в поддерживаемый тип.

UEFI поддерживает такую опцию, как Secure Boot, которая она позволяет проверять целостность загрузчика при запуске системы и отменять его, если будут обнаружены неавторизованные изменения. Последняя важная особенность, которую нужно иметь в виду – улучшенная поддержка вариантов сетевой загрузки, что позволяет устанавливать операционные системы через подключение к локальной или общей сети. Такая возможность была и в старых версиях служебного ПО материнской платы, однако в новом типе она поддерживает практически все доступные на сегодня протоколы соединения.

В то же время следует иметь в виду важную особенность: UEFI рассчитан на современные операционные системы, то есть Windows 8, 8.1, 10 и 11. Семёрку на компьютер с этим вариантом программного обеспечения платы так просто не установить. Впрочем, производители учитывают подобное, поэтому, как правило, имеется возможность переключить режим загрузки в Legacy, тот самый старый добрый BIOS.

Таким образом, резюмируя всё обозначенное в настоящей статье, можем сделать вывод – для Windows 10 режим UEFI является не просто предпочтительным, а необходимым в большинстве случаев.
Что такое legacy USB support и Legacy BIOS
Многие пользователи персональных компьютеров сталкиваются с проблемой непонимания терминов в BIOS (в переводе базовая система ввода-вывода). БИОС отвечает за работу с комплектующими компьютера и подключенными к нему устройствами. В частности, часто вызывает недоумение пункт «Legacy Support» в настройках, а также Legacy режим БИОСа.
Что такое legacy USB support
Функция Legacy USB Support используется для активации или дезактивации поддержки USB-девайсов на уровне БИОСа. Например, если рядом с именем функции значатся пункты mouse или keyboard, это означает работу только мышки или клавиатуры.
Функция может принимать следующие значения (в зависимости от модели BIOS могут быть не все варианты):
- disabled – выключение функции, активация работы всех usb-девайсов;
- enabled – активация клавиатуры и мышки, работающих по интерфейсу usb, на уровне BIOS;
- AUTO – дезактивирует работу клавиатуры и мышки работающих по протоколу PS/2, если к портам usb компьютера подключены устройства такого же типа;
- BIOS (иногда only BIOS)– осуществление функционирования usb-девайсов на уровне материнской платы компьютера;
- OS – осуществление функционирования usb-девайсов при помощи операционной системы;
- Keyboard – разрешает включение только usb-клавиатуры средствами BIOS;
- Mouse – можно использовать только мышь;
- ALLDEVICE – разрешает включение всех девайсов, подключенных к портам USB;
- Nomice – включает все usb-устройства, но мышка остается нерабочей;

Пункт располагается в отделе «Advanced». Навигация по меню БИОС реализуется при помощи кнопок со стрелками, кнопкой «Enter» для подтверждения своего выбора и клавишей «ESC» для выхода из меню. Для осуществления входа в БИОС при запуске ПК нужно успеть нажать кнопку ESC, F2 или DEL до начала работы операционной системы.
Как включить legacy usb support
Если необходимо включить этот пункт настроек в меню БИОСа, необходимо его запустить, потом войти в раздел «Advanced» и, используя кнопки со стрелками найти требуемый пункт меню, так, чтобы он подсвечивался.
Потом нажать Enter и при помощи стрелок выбрать значение «Enabled», после чего подтвердить свой выбор, опять нажав «Enter». Выбор, включать или нет пункт, зависит исключительно от пользователя и его предпочтений. Если нужно добиться максимального функционала, на который способны девайсы работающие по интерфейсу юсб, следует включить этот пункт.

Но следует учитывать, что в данном случае до начала работы операционной системы эти виды устройств будут не доступны для использования. При использовании устаревших версий операционных систем, таких как DOS или Windows 95, активация данного пункта настроек является обязательной.
UEFI или Legacy – что выбрать
Иногда понятие Legacy применяют к устаревшей версии БИОСа, т.е. называют BIOS Legacy. На его замену пришла более современная модель – UEFI.
UEFI – это технология, реализующая те же функции, что и BIOS Legacy. По сути UEFI – просто современная версия базовой системы ввода-вывода, которая лучше всего подходит для Windows 10 последних версий. В Windows 7 и 8 также можно использовать режим УЕФИ, но тут это не так принципиально, хотя во многом это зависит от установленных компонентов. Если кроме материнской платы все компоненты компьютера достаточно старые, то UEFI не принесет каких-либо заметных улучшений в работу ПК.
UEFI работает с современными системами и не имеет многих ограничений БИОСа. Некоторые модели материнских плат позволяют изменять режим между UEFI и Legacy в пункте boot mode. Более детально об отличиях можно узнать в нашей статье.
Так как UEFI изначально задумывалась как окончательная замена БИОСу со временем, советуется выбирать ее как наиболее перспективную. В отличие от традиционного BIOS-Legacy, UEFI обладает рядом преимуществ, к котором стоит отнести:
- Снятие ограничения на объем разделов и их число.
- Повышенная скорость.
- Улучшенная производительность.
- Усиленная безопасность.
- Поддержка загрузки при помощи сети.
- Совместимость с предыдущими версиями BIOS.
- Наличие менеджера загрузки.
Каждый пользователь ПК сам выбирает для себя, что ему выбирать – повышенную функциональность устройств или возможность работы с ним до загрузки операционной системы. То же можно сказать и про UEFI и BIOS – первый более современен, второй более привычен. Делать выбор надо исходя из собственных предпочтений, но при этом руководствоваться вышеизложенной информацией.
UEFI and Legacy explained
![]()
Once upon a time in the 70’s, when Davies(one of our smartest authors) was just but a possibility of happening, BIOS was born. BIOS (Basic Input/Output System) was among the first firmware to be released. It was introduced by IBM or as it was popularly known ‘the big blue’. Computer firmware is software that acts as an intermediary between the hardware and the operating system. In the past, BIOS was the thing but it is slowly getting out of the picture as it cannot be able to handle some of the advanced features of modern hardware.
Legacy BIOS
Legacy is the old BIOS way of doing things. Yes, it is fading out of relevance but that is not to mean that it is useless now. There is a reason it is still a boot option in our machines.
Legacy is run by Read Only Memory (ROM’s) which is limited to 64 KB of storage. These ROMs only work if the hardware that is running them is compatible. You have to update the ROM’s whenever you update your hardware.
Legacy BIOS uses the Master Boot Recovery partitioning scheme.
In MBR:
The maximum partition size is 2TB
You can have a maximum of 4 primary partitions
You can only store one bootloader
UEFI (Unified Extensible Firmware Interface) is the successor to BIOS. UEFI uses drivers in place of ROM’s. These drivers have no space limitations and you don’t need to keep updating every time you upgrade your hardware. You can upload these drivers using a flash drive.
UEFI uses the GUID Partition Table (GPT) while Legacy uses MBR. Both GPT and MBR are formats that specify the physical partitioning information on the hard disk.
In GPT:
The maximum partition size is 9 ZetaBytes
You can have 128 primary partitions
You can store multiple bootloaders since GPT has a dedicated EFI System Partition (ESP)
UEFI offers secure boot which prevents viruses from loading during boot-time.
UEFI uses C language, unlike Legacy which uses Assembly language. Working with Legacy can be a bit harder as the code is long and confusing. The thing I have learnt about long and confusing lines of code is that they end up causing developers to write more long and confusing lines of code. C on the hand is easy to work with as it is well structured (those who know me know that I am a C die hard)
Due to being newer and more advanced, UEFI supports faster boot time than Legacy mode.
Choosing what mode you want to use is entirely up to you. Running on Legacy won’t have you at a big disadvantage as long as you don’t mind slower boot. Legacy has been running for a very long time and is quite reliable.
UEFI is for the control junkies who want to control everything that happens on their systems. Well, keep choosing until Legacy fades away and UEFI becomes the reigning survivor.
Загрузка в UEFI или BIOS Legacy на примере платы Biostar IH61MF-Q5

Итак, вы решили установить Windows c загрузочной флешки, но вот незадача – BIOS (UEFI) почему-то не видит носитель. Ничего страшного – нужно лишь немного изменить дефолтные настройки.
О том, что нужно сделать, чтобы загрузочный носитель отобразился в Boot Menu, вы и узнаете в сегодняшней статье.
Что такое UEFI и Legacy
UEFI и Legacy — это два режима BIOS для загрузки дисков, которые отличаются методом запуска операционной системы и типом интерфейса.
Отличия UEFI и Legacy
| UEFI | Legacy | |
| Оформление | Графический интерфейс | Классический BIOS |
| Формат загрузки дисков | GPT | MBR |
| Загрузка драйверов | Есть | Нет |
| Наличие Secure Boot | Да | Нет |
| Сколько разделов можно создать | Нет лимита | 4 раздела по 2 Тб |
| Режим загрузки | EFI и Legacy | Legacy |
Почему UEFI не видит флешку?
Основная причина такой проблемы – режим загрузки флешки не соответствует режиму загрузки UEFI. Современные компьютеры поддерживают два режима загрузки – Legacy и EFI. Но по умолчанию включен только один из них, и, как правило, это EFI. А вот вашей загрузочной флешке как раз нужен именно Legacy.
Все, что нам нужно сделать в этом случае – выставить оба режима загрузки, чтобы BIOS увидел флешку и сумел ее прочитать.
Настройка запуска с флешки (UEFI/LEGACY)
Для этого нам потребуется:
- подключенная к монитору материнская плата,
- клавиатура.
Порядок действий
-
Включаем плату и, пока не началась загрузка ОС, успеваем нажать F2 или DEL (комбинация может быть и другой – например, у НР это F10) для выхода в BIOS.